clone_private_mount() doesn't need to touch namespace_sem
not for CL_PRIVATE clone_mnt() Signed-off-by: Al Viro <viro@zeniv.linux.org.uk>
This commit is contained in:
parent
f4cc1c3810
commit
066715d3fd
|
@ -1795,9 +1795,7 @@ struct vfsmount *clone_private_mount(struct path *path)
|
|||
if (IS_MNT_UNBINDABLE(old_mnt))
|
||||
return ERR_PTR(-EINVAL);
|
||||
|
||||
down_read(&namespace_sem);
|
||||
new_mnt = clone_mnt(old_mnt, path->dentry, CL_PRIVATE);
|
||||
up_read(&namespace_sem);
|
||||
if (IS_ERR(new_mnt))
|
||||
return ERR_CAST(new_mnt);
|
||||
|
||||
|
|
Loading…
Reference in New Issue